I believe the infatuation here in the US with sport wagons is the fact that they've been a forbidden fruit for so long, only getting some of them sprinkled in sporadically - domestic and foreign.

In all honesty, I love the concept and think they're cool as shit but I would never buy one. It's meant to be sporty and practical but it's worse at both than it's counterparts, the sedan and the SUV. In other words, if a sport sedan is not practical enough for you, you might as well just get a performance SUV. And people do, and I doubt that this time it will be any different.

TL;DR

It's cool because it's different, and everyone wants one until there's actually one for sale - then no one buys one.
